a. isle (literary)
A word or phrase restricted in usage to literature or established writing (e.g., sex, once upon a time).
Los exploradores viajaron a las ínsulas del Caribe en busca de especias extranjeras.The explorers traveled to the isles of the Caribbean in search of foreign spices.
b. island
Los piratas avistaron una ínsula con sus catalejos.The pirates spotted an island with their telescopes.
